What to Bring
- Driver must bring a valid ID
- Personal camping gear (tents, sleeping bags, etc.) or we can provide anything needed.
- We get a lot of sun in Southern Arizona so we always suggest packing your sunscreen even in winter
- Please wear long sleeves and long pants with closed-toed shoes, especially if you want to take a wander around our beautiful backyard
- You should bring plenty of water and trail type snacks and/or a packed lunch
Helmets and goggles are included.
How Safe is Riding the Trails?
Riding out on the trails is a fun and exhilarating experience but you do need to be careful and pay attention to what is around you. There are inherent risks involved with trail riding and common sense is a must. Prior to sending you out for your adventure, we will give you a thorough briefing as we want you to have nothing but a great and safe ride.
